1. Modern :
At present,
the modern interior is one of the most trendy & aesthetic interior design
styles. It emerges in the early 20th century. In this style, simplicity is
reflected in every item. It highlights clean lines, warm woods, natural
materials & earthy tones. Modern style is often confused with contemporary
style for the similarities.

2. Scandinavian :
The
Scandinavian style is popular for its simple & aesthetic look. Its first
comes out in the 1920s. The style is characterized by simplicity, minimalism
& a neutral heavy color palette. Natural woods are used in this style. The style is truly beautiful, you can apply this one for an elegant look.

3. Contemporary :
Though
contemporary & modern art seems to be similar but contemporary style refers
to present-day design. The style is focused on simplicity and minimalism. Grey,
beige & shades of white are the main color in this style. Contemporary
furniture is what reflects the trend & styles. Overall, Contemporary is a
trendy interior style with a beautiful appearance.

4. Industrial :
Industrial
style is also called industrial chic. It is a popular design style for its
versatility. The style emphasizes wood, metal & concrete. It consists of a
rich color palette that mix of neutral colors. The design is based on
minimalist & open space. Lighting accents are also used in this style.

5. Japandi :
Japandi
design is a combination of two rustic styles, Scandinavian & Japanese. For
the mixture, the style has gained more popularity. It looks so elegant for its
minimalism, simplicity & neutral colors. It emphasized sparse decor &
natural handmade elements.

6. Minimalist :
The concept
of minimalist interior design is simplicity. It's all about prioritizing the
essentials. The style is distinguished by a monochromatic color palette, open
floor plans & limited furniture. It refers to natural lights. Minimalist
style inspires us to use natural resources & products without wasting them.

7. Mid-Century:
The mid-century
modern interior is recognized for its retro style & became popular in the
early 1900s. The style is considered a subset of modern design. It is
characterized by clean lines, muted tones, vibrant colors & integration
indoors. It focuses on a combination of natural & organic elements. The
style can thoroughly create a modern elegant look in your interior.

8. Electic :
Eclectic
interior design is about an elegant space that is a mix & match of
different design styles. The style can create versatility in your interior. It
is characterized by a playful color palette & patterns with unique accents.
There are no specific rules to apply you can present your personality in your
interior.

9. Traditional :
Traditional interior is always
timeless & comfortable. If you are looking for a classic interior design
then you can apply this style. It is based largely on the 18th and 19th
centuries. Traditional decorating relies on decorative woodwork, rich-dark
colors & floral patterns. It is a
symmetrically arranged interior style with silk, linen, and velvet
upholsteries.

10. Coastal :
Coastal is a simple interior
design with a beachy vibe. The style incorporates natural seaside elements like
natural woods, jute, rattan & linen fabrics. It looks so aesthetic with
shades of blue, green & white that are mostly used in this style. Coastal
style brings natural light & makes your interior feel bright, airy &
beachy.
